Being new here I'm checking out The Villages Health System. I would need to join the Florida Blue Advantage plan and suspend my Federal Retiree Blue Cross coverage. I have no experience with an HMO system. Three questions come to mind.
1. If you have experience with Villages Health would you be willing to share any thoughts or experiences about it?
2. Have you suspended your federal retiree coverage to do this and are you satisfied with that decision?
3. If I keep my federal retiree coverage does this area provide enough adequate health care providers outside the TV HMO system without traveling to the cities?

I am retired and have FepBlue. It is handled by Florida Blue in Florida. When I lived in another state it was handled by their version of BlueCross/BlueShield. I did not keep Medicare part B because I saw no reason to pay over $300 per month for both of us when we had complete coverage via FepBlue or FloridaBlue or whatever you wish to call it. I still receive my insurance card from FepBlue.
There is no difference in you FepBlue coverage here as anywhere else. You still have FepBlue.
